Gary Jody Childers, the 50-year-old man wanted for allegedly shooting at DeKalb County deputies during a car chase, is arrested in Floyd County, Georgia, following a complex investigation that included multiple false leads. The chase began when deputies attempted to stop Childers’ van, leading him to fire at officers before he crashed and fled on foot, abandoning a bag containing a second firearm, methamphetamine, and over $23,000 in cash.
Childers faces serious charges, including attempted murder and possession of a firearm as a felon, with additional federal charges pending. Previously on probation for a federal conviction related to armed robbery, his latest actions have reignited concerns about his ongoing criminal behavior and substance abuse. Authorities have hailed the collaborative effort of various law enforcement agencies involved in the swift capture of Childers, who will remain in custody until extradition to Alabama.
